Recommended jazz band classics (1–10)
So WhatMiles Davis

The jazz standard “So What,” credited on Miles Davis’s classic album Kind of Blue, is a standout track that advances the hard bop style and establishes a new musical approach known as modal jazz.
Built on a single minor chord with simple changes that pivot up a half step at key moments, the piece features improvisation using the church mode known as the Dorian scale, delivering a thrilling performance.
The evolving, performance-driven jazz style of the time is essential listening!

Don’t Bite The DustLOVEBITES

Formed in 2016 by former members of DESTROSE, this band delivers a quintessential, ultra-traditional heavy metal sound.
With technical guitar phrases and soaring vocals, they embody the classic, straight-down-the-line style of the genre.

Time capsuleAo

A delivering emotional rock sound, Ao is a three-woman band formed in April 2024.
The band was launched by its central figure, Zarame, in pursuit of new musical expression.
Zarame’s warm, powerful vocals combined with the driving sound created by Momo and maki have captured the hearts of many music fans.
Their nationwide eight-city tour, the “Beyond Baby Blue tour,” ran from October to November 2024, traveling from Shibuya to Fukuoka, Hiroshima, Kobe, Osaka, Nagoya, and Sendai, and concluded with a solo show at Ebisu LIQUIDROOM.
Taking its name from “Ao,” meaning blue—symbolizing youth and new beginnings—the band pours an unyielding spirit of dreams and hope into their songs.
Ao is highly recommended for anyone who wants to enjoy music with a positive outlook.
Make up your mind!Sabasusutā

Sabasister is a three-piece girls’ band formed in March 2022 that has quickly become a must-watch act, now making waves at music festivals across the country.
Their debut release, “Saba no Ichi,” dropped in September 2022 and sparked buzz for its lyrics and melodies woven from a uniquely personal sensibility and choice of words.
Remarkably, they performed at SUMMER SONIC just five months after forming, gaining attention at an exceptional pace.
Their songs blend familiar, catchy pop with powerful rock ’n’ roll energy—perfect for anyone seeking fresh new music.
We’re in the car again today.Hump Back

Formed in 2009, Hump Back is a three-piece rock band from Osaka.
These days, you just can’t talk about girl bands without mentioning them! Their addictive vocal delivery and straightforward playing make you feel the same excitement as a kid discovering rock for the first time.
Their performance feels like it turns the indescribable directly into sound, and the heartfelt lyrics delivered by vocalist Momoko Hayashi’s passionate voice really hit home.
As long as you’re listening to Hump Back, it feels like you can stay in your youth forever.
BestieBAND-MAID

As the name suggests, BAND-MAID is a girls’ band whose trademark is maid outfits.
Despite their cute appearance, they deliver a pretty hard rock sound.
In 2014, an overseas web radio station introduced their music video on Facebook, and they became a hot topic worldwide.
